Bioactivity Lipoxamycin is an antifungal antibiotic and a potent serine palmitoyltransferase inhibitor with an IC50 of 21 nM[1][2].
Invitro Lipoxamycin has antifungal activity against a panel of humanpathogenic fungi with better potency against some of the Candida species (MIC values, 0.25-16 µg/mL). Cryptococcus neoformans is the most sensitive organism, followed by various species of Candida. Other filamentous fungi are sensitive to the Lipoxamycin in disk diffusion assays[1].Lipoxamycin has a long alkyl chain and an amino-containing polar head group. Lipoxamycin is on the same order of potency as the sphingofungins and also have potent activity against the mammalianenzyme[1].
